Can 7k Trailer Brake Assemblies be Used in 6k Trailer Axle Hub/Drums  

Question:

I have a trailer with 6k axles. Will the 7k lb brakes Dexter work on these axles as long as the brake drum is the same size?

0

Expert Reply:

Yes, 7k trailer axle brake assemblies like # 23-180-181 will fit 6k axle hub/drums. They use the exact same dimensions and bolt patterns which allows that. The difference is the strength or sensitivity of the magnets in the assemblies. The 7k axles have a magnet that is more sensitive and will pull harder on the drums. This might seem like it would give you more stopping power but in reality a 6k assembly set would just as easily lock up the brakes so there is no more stopping power gained. In reality it'll just make the brake controller setup a little more difficult as the sweet spot for brake output power will be harder to find. The best solution is to go with brake assemblies that were designed for 6k axles like the part # 23-105-106 for manual adjust or part # 23-458-459 for self adjusting assemblies.
